What is being bought
NHS England Central Health & Justice team, has an established a multi-Provider Framework Agreement for the provision of Lived Experience services and wishes to open a new window (window 1) to allow new providers to apply. The aim of this framework agreement is to implement a compliant and streamlined route to market for NHS organisations to facilitate the procurement of a wide range of services relating to procuring lived experience input across: - Health & Justice sector - Armed Forces sector - Sexual Assault Referral Services (SARCs) - Children & Young People services - Domestic Abuse & Sexual Violence - Learning Disability, Neurodiversity & Autism - Migrant Health This Framework can be used by any NHS organisation in England including ICBs, CSUs, NHS Trusts and Foundation Trusts. Lots and requirements (7)
Published by the contracting authority
  • Lot 1 · #1
    Lot 1 - Health & Justice sector
    active
    Published valueNot published
    The key objective is open a new window to allow new providers to apply to an existing Framework, across multiple Lived Experience specialities (including where a Provider may be able to support more than one category): - Health & Justice sector - Armed Forces sector - Sexual Assault Referral Services (SARCs) - Children & Young People services - Domestic Abuse & Sexual Violence - Learning Disability, Neurodiversity & Autism -Migrant Health (NEW LOT) This Framework can be used by any NHS organisation in England including ICBs, CSUs, NHS Trusts and Foundation Trusts. The Provider will provide Lived Experience services on a Call-off basis for NHS England and/or Participating Authorities (any NHS organisation) as required. Please note, that this Procurement is to open a new window (window 1) to allow new providers to be added to the Framework and not to immediately award any Call-Off Contracts. The process for awarding call-off contracts is described further in procurement documentation. This procurement will establish a Framework and as such there is no guaranteed contract value, however the process that is being undertaken will allow Call-Off contracts to be awarded via this framework.
